One of my favorite accuracy/varmint loads for the .22-250 Rem was 34.5 grains of IMR 4895, using Sierra 55 grain, Semi-Pointed bullets.

My rifle loves 34 grains of IMR-4895 with a 52 grain BTHP. That load has served me well and taken many groundhogs. That was a load that my reloading mentor started me with years and years ago.
